Official record
Development description
(1) minor alterations to elevations and layout of previously granted storage sheds under file ref 19/1274. (2) retention of existing steel silo and ancillary works, stone walls and timber cladding-required for the installation of new heating system. Full planning permission for (3) conversion of an existing granted machinery store under file ref 19/1274 to a new kitchen facility to service wedding guests. (4) conversion of an existing store unit to restaurant facility for the use of wedding guests. (5) the conversion of an upper floor loft space to 2 no. Bedroom en suite accommodation units. (6) proposed new lean to extension circa 191 sq. M. To the rear of the existing reception room and store (now proposed restaurant) which will provide for more suitable location for vintage machinery store, wood store and a proposed new alcohol and keg store and all associated site works
